What to do while you wait for your Ojai appointment

  • Rinse, do not scrub: warm salt water every few hours calms the gum and clears debris around a cracked or infected tooth.
  • Cold, not heat: a wrapped ice pack on the cheek limits swelling. Heat spreads it.
  • Keep the pieces: a chipped fragment or a crown that came off can sometimes be reattached, so bring it with you.
  • Eat carefully: soft foods, nothing very hot or cold, and chew away from the sore side until you are seen.

Should I go to an Ojai hospital ER for tooth pain?
Only if you have swelling that affects breathing or swallowing, uncontrolled bleeding, or a jaw fracture. Hospital emergency rooms in Ventura County generally cannot pull teeth or treat the cause. An emergency dentist can.
